I'll tell ya one thing, b'y, you'd think in da House of Assembly, da place where all da big decisions for our province get made, you'd have a bit of respect, eh? But no, not dese ones. Da Speaker, Paul Lane himself, had to stand up dere and give 'em all a proper scolding about dere decorum, tellin' 'em to wise up. And whaddya think happened? Two of 'em, a Liberal and a PC, went right ahead and lost dere speakin' privileges da very next day! Just like a couple of school kids after bein' told to sit down.

Now, I'm not sayin' politics ain't heated, especially wit' all da big challenges we got here in St. John's and 'round da bay – like da gas prices goin' over two dollars a litre, b'y! But when you're elected to represent da people, to speak for 'em, and you're gettin' told off like dat, it really makes you wonder. It's not just about one MHA bein' a bit too boisterous, it's about da whole tone down dere on Confederation Hill. You want to see 'em focused on da issues, on da folks strugglin' to make ends meet, not on who can shout loudest or interrupt da most.
